Transaction 908cae61b3b0530deb0bcb4413bfbfc171e395b0e17969bdbd3b17ece10de738
1 Input
1 Outputs
- 908cae61b3b0530deb0bcb4413bfbfc171e395b0e17969bdbd3b17ece10de738:0
value 7425234
address 39NaYynVvRriVdcSPKB19AM9Y1bDVbLjYc